A Decade of Curation and Evolution

Way Out West has long operated differently than its European festival counterparts. By rejecting the "mega-festival" model in favor of a boutique, urban-integrated experience, organizers have cultivated a loyal demographic that values discovery over spectacle. The 2026 edition underscored this philosophy, emphasizing a mix of established legacy acts and underground heavyweights that demand active listening rather than passive attendance.

The festival’s operational success remains tethered to its strict commitment to sustainability. Since its inception, the decision to eliminate meat from all catering options has moved from a controversial talking point to a standard expectation. In 2026, the festival further expanded its circularity initiatives, reducing waste footprints through integrated public transit incentives and digital-only ticketing systems. This focus on "mindful consumption" serves as a core pillar of the Way Out West brand, distinguishing it from the often profit-first motivations seen in larger global event circuits.

Navigating the Slottsskogen Landscape

For attendees and critics reviewing the event this year, the "Stay Out West" component remains the most vital utility for maximizing the festival experience. Because the primary park festivities traditionally conclude in the early evening, the citywide takeover of clubs and venues offers a secondary layer of programming that extends the festival pulse deep into the night.

Critics have noted that the 2026 navigation plan effectively managed crowd flow between the main stages and the more intimate forest-clearing sets. The utility of the official festival app—which provides real-time updates on stage capacities and secret set locations—proved essential for those attempting to catch high-demand acts. Access remains a premium, with the tiered ticket system favoring those who secure passes months in advance to gain entry into the most exclusive club venues during the nighttime sessions.
